Output 7ef5b99dc5e0ba183793575d8dbb6520e7271be82a02102efaf4d41ad34f44f1:0

value
667225
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a13d9b9d88abd99e6904b60f3b56882156741d6 OP_EQUAL
address
3BMuL7aEbSHic5BTy1PdeSRRBQQE3rkFcz
transaction
7ef5b99dc5e0ba183793575d8dbb6520e7271be82a02102efaf4d41ad34f44f1
spent
true